akte

Meaning

  1. (feminine) act (of a theatrical play)
  2. (feminine) legal instrument, deed
  3. (feminine) a certificate, a licence, a diploma or, in general, any official document that gives legal evidence to something

Hyphenated as
ak‧te
Pronounced as (IPA)
/ˈɑk.tə/
Etymology

From Middle Dutch acte, from Old French acte, from Latin ācta, plural of āctum.
